Lee County saw dip in killings in 2009

By
Real Estate Agent with Century 21 Sunbelt Realty

Homicides last year dropped 8 percent from 2008 and 17 percent over the last two years in Lee County.

The local drop mirrors a national trend. The FBI announced a 4.4 percent decrease nationwide for the first half of 2009 compared with the same period a year earlier.

Those in local law enforcement are pleased with the decline.

In Fort Myers, many of the homicides were drug-related. In the Cape, three-fourths were domestic. At the sheriff's office, the motives were more varied; no one reason dominated, but there was a mix of domestic violence, drug crimes and robbery.

Cape Coral had a total of 4 Murders in 2009. Cape Coral has a clearance rate of 100 percent, and has maintained that record for 15 years.
